- [ ] Step 7: Archive cold storage buckets (Glacierline tier). Confirm both ceremony witnesses are present, verify bucket manifests match the Oxbow ledger, then seal the archive key shares. Plugin authors may observe but not handle shares. Once sealed, the archive index itself is encrypted and can only be reopened with the passphrase below.

vault phrase of badup-hahig = tamael-aldael-kelmir-istael-fenok-istwyn-tamius-jorath-oliion

Handover note — GalleryEcho audio-guide backend

Taking over from me is Dario; this note is for the security review. GalleryEcho serves tour audio to visitor devices at the Fenwright Museum over TLS only, with signed bundle manifests. Admin endpoints are restricted to the staff VLAN. No open findings from the last internal scan. The service currently runs with the following configuration values.

deployment values, yadug-bawif:
[framir]
team = pelox
access_code = ac_a38ab2
owner = tamion.julael
host = framir.tolvaqlabs.test
port = 11211
peer = tammir.zemvargrid.local
salt = 2215ef03
pin = 1541

Subject: Memory leak in Lanternfox image cache — hotfix shipping today

Team,

Support has seen rising crash reports on Lanternfox 4.2 tied to the thumbnail image cache. The cache never evicts decoded bitmaps after gallery scroll, so memory climbs until the OS kills the app. Affected users will see slowdowns after roughly ten minutes of browsing.

A hotfix with a bounded LRU cache goes out this afternoon. Please point escalations at the new build once it lands. When filing follow-up tickets, reference the build token below.

trace token, kahog-tajeg: htk6_97d963

Canary gating for Pellgrove deploys: promotion blocked unless error rate stays under 0.5% for 30 minutes and the auth-latency check passes twice. Security-sensitive changes additionally require the policy scanner to report clean on the canary image. Overrides need two approvals and are logged. Verify the audit entry matches the canary's build token, recorded below.

pipeline stamp: htk4_ae36